The Silent Witness: Inside the World of a Forensic Toxicologist
Forensic toxicologists perform a essential and often obscure role in the justice system, acting as silent analysts to events that have occurred. Their typical work involves read more the precise examination of organic samples – fluids, urine, and even hair – seeking traces of drugs, poisons, or alcohol. The process isn't just about finding these agents; it’s about measuring their levels to establish the degree of exposure and its likely contribution to an investigation. Beyond the laboratory, these specialists consult with law officials, lawyers, and medical professionals, offering expert testimony and key insights. In essence, their conclusions can drastically impact judgements in a variety of incidents: from motor vehicle under the effect to suspected fatalities.
- Examination of multiple biological samples.
- Communication with investigators.
- Providing expert evidence.
Decoding the Digital Trail: Becoming a Digital Forensic analyst
Becoming a digital forensic professional involves examining the complex evidence left behind in the digital world . You’ll acquire skills in recovering deleted data, locating sources of intrusions, and documenting your findings in a concise manner. A strong foundation in computer engineering , coupled with training like those from (ISC)² or GIAC, is often necessary . The career demands detailed attention to specifics and a dedication to ethical practice within a legal setting.
Outside the Yellow Line: The Facts of Being a Crime Scene Investigator
Forget the drama of television; the life of a crime scene investigator is often a grueling mix of {long shifts , meticulous analysis , and exposure to upsetting scenes. Many believe it involves solely collecting clues and resolving puzzles, but the truth is far more complex . Investigators frequently spend considerable time photographing the scene , securing important evidence , and meticulously processing physical specimens. The burden to ensure precision and proper handling is immense , and the psychological toll can be significant , frequently unseen by the public .
Forensic Analysis: From The Scene of the Crime to the Judicial System
Forensic analysis plays a critical role in the contemporary justice framework. Beginning focused on elementary observation and tracking, it has evolved into a complex field employing a broad range of procedures. From collecting clues at crime scenes to examining tangible samples like genetic material, forensic specialists carefully understand data to reconstruct events. This evidence is then presented in the legal setting to assist the court and juries in delivering a fair judgment.
Forensic Toxicology and Innovation: The Evolving Positions in Contemporary Criminal Investigations
Previously, analytical toxicology depended on time-consuming lab procedures. Yet, the developments in tech, like mass spectrometry, chromatography, and artificial intelligence, have begun to radically reshaping the area. This instrumentation permit for faster analysis of biological samples, enhanced detection power, and the capacity to identify new poisons. In addition, computer forensics techniques are increasingly utilized to interpret data generated by testing equipment, leading to more precise and thorough criminal investigations.
